Call for Papers
The Charlotte Perkins Gilman conference brings together those working on Gilman around the country and around the world to exchange ideas and to share their work. While the keynote address, the plenary session, and other special events will focus on the conference theme, Gilman Goes West, we welcome submissions on any topic pertaining to Gilman's life and/or work. Moreover, we invite papers taking a wide variety of approaches and disciplinary perspectives. We will also consider submissions in nontraditional formats, such as roundtable discussions, complete panels of three papers on a single topic, film/video, performance or visual art. We encourage students to participate in the conference and will, again this year, offer an award for the Best Student Paper.
To submit a proposal, send an abstract (250 words) and a one-page CV by February 15, 2011 to the conference email (gilmanconference@umontana.edu). For panel proposals, send a description of the panel theme, 250-word abstracts for each paper, the name of the panel chair, and 1-page CVs for each participant.
If you are a student and wish to be considered for the Best Student Paper Award, send your complete paper (of a length suitable for presenting in a twenty-minute block of time), along with a one-page CV to the address above by May 15, 2011. Names will be removed for the judging process.
